EDITORS COMMENTS
This engraving transports us back to the grandeur of Vienna in 1869. The focus of the image is the majestic Vienna State Opera House, standing proudly amidst a bustling street scene. The artist, Rudolph von Alt, skillfully captures the intricate details of this architectural masterpiece, showcasing its Neo-Renaissance style with utmost precision. The Vienna State Opera House is an iconic symbol of Viennese culture and history. Its imposing façade exudes elegance and sophistication, drawing visitors from all corners of the world. As we gaze at this print, we can almost imagine ourselves strolling along Ringstrasse, taking in the sights and sounds of this vibrant city. Alt's meticulous attention to detail allows us to appreciate not only the grandeur of the opera house but also the surrounding buildings and streetscape. Every line etched into this engraving tells a story - a snapshot frozen in time that encapsulates both past glory and present vitality. Displayed against a backdrop devoid of color, this monochromatic print emphasizes both light and shadow, adding depth to every element within its frame. It invites us to explore every nook and cranny with our eyes – from ornate balconies adorned with statues to intricately designed arches that adorn its entrance. As we admire this historical artwork by Rudolph von Alt through Fine Art Finder's lens, it serves as a reminder that art has an incredible power: it enables us to travel through time while appreciating beauty that transcends generations
